In January 2026, Black Diamond Pool inside Biscuit Basin at Yellowstone National Park erupted twice — on January 19th and again on January 24th. That kind of repeated hydrothermal activity in such a short time span is unusual, and it has scientists watching closely. What caused these eruptions? Are they connected to the 2024 Biscuit Basin hydrothermal explosion? Does this signal rising underground pressure? And could more eruptions happen?
